The tasks of a zookeeper usually include the care and maintenance of animals such as preparing food and keeping the places clean and safe. In general, you need to make detailed observations, as well as help in the capture and restriction of animals. Keeping records is usually part of the job too.
In addition to becoming a zookeeper, the course can also pave the way for jobs as a VET assistant and wildlife officer. You can also work for confinement centres, animal hospitals, day care centres and protection agencies. Specialized zookeepers commonly take care of areas specialized in the handling of exotic animals and animals.
Zoo specialists can focus on the care and management of native or exotic mammals, amphibians, reptiles, birds, invertebrates, training animals, fish, veterinarians or other specialized areas of animal management.
